  • We have been created and prepared ahead to do good works. Therefore, our whole lives should be devoted unto good works (Rom 12:1-3, Col 3:17).
  • We have been commissioned to preach the good news to all nations, heal the sick, deliver oppressed, cast out demons etc. Good works would push us even further to pray and nurture the new believers unto maturity so they can stand firm and do same to others (Ephesians 4:13-15).
  • Good works is not limited to what we do in the church, it also encapsulates what we do in the secular world. Eph 2:10.
  • Making Jesus known through good works means full alignment to the commandment/will of God. John 14:15, Gal 2:20.
  • Jesus reveals Himself to the world through a show of His loving kindness(works) through our relationships/network (Rom 2:4).
  • We can make Jesus known through simple things such as a kind word, an encouraging text/ e-mail, Face time, paying for /preparing a meal for someone, transportation assistance, or merely a listening ear.
  • By showing acts of Kindness, love, empathy and forgiveness, we can make Jesus known to people (Luke 7:36–50).
  • We are saved by Grace and not by our works; good works are tangible evidence to the world that in deed Jesus is good. Our works are supposed to be product of salvation and not its justification. (Psalm 34:8. Ephesians 2:8)
  • The Gospel is not complete without good works, God works are actually the fruit of the salvation (Ephesians 2:10, Matthew 14:16, James 2:14).
  • We need to be very deliberate at ensuring our good works is enshrined in love and compassion (Matthew 6:2-5)
  • The ultimate good works resulting in Salvation is made possible through the sacrificial death of Jesus on the cross.
